Django contrib管理员默认管理员和密码

时间:2016-09-26 06:47:16

标签: django

这可能是一个愚蠢的问题。我开始一个新的Django项目,正如Document所说,它只包含一个管理页面。我启动服务器并使用访问该页面的Web浏览器。我可以在用户名和密码中输入什么?他们可以在任何地方配置默认的管理员帐户吗?

3 个答案:

答案 0 :(得分:53)

您可以在shell

中使用以下命令行进行配置
python manage.py createsuperuser

基本上,您正在创建可以访问django管理面板的超级用户。

答案 1 :(得分:9)

首先,您需要运行migrate以更改管理员用户名和密码。运行

python manage.py migrate

然后使用

编辑用户名和密码
python manage.py createsuperuser

然后提供用户名和密码以及电子邮件。

答案 2 :(得分:1)

您需要创建一个超级用户才能访问django admin

python manage.py createsuperuser

只需输入用户名,电子邮件和密码(您输入的密码在Powershell中是不可见的,但会保存密码)